Abstract
A system, device, and method for mixing liquids involves pumping a first liquid into a first pump chamber of a pumping apparatus through a channel of the pumping apparatus and pumping a second liquid from a second pump chamber of the pumping apparatus into either the channel or the first pump chamber, preferably while the first liquid is being pumped into the first pump chamber, so that the two liquids are mixed within the pumping apparatus. The second liquid is preferably pumped in a pulsatile mode in which small quantities of the second liquid are pumped at intervals. The quantity and/or the interval can be dynamically adjusted to result in a predetermined concentration of the two liquids. The contents of the first pump chamber are pumped to a receptacle.

9. A system for mixing a first liquid with a second liquid, the system comprising:
-
a plurality of first liquid containers, each containing a first liquid;
a second liquid container containing a second liquid; anda plurality of pumping assemblies, each pumping assembly in valved fluid communication with a separate first liquid container, and each pumping assembly in valved fluid communication with the second liquid container such that the second liquid from the second liquid container can be mixed in each of the plurality of pumping assemblies with liquid from each of the plurality of first liquid containers, wherein each pumping assembly comprises; a first pump chamber in valved fluid communication through a channel with a second pump chamber, each pump chamber having a variable volume, the volume depending on the position of a barrier separating the pump chamber from a positive or negative pressure source, the pump chamber being capable of pumping liquid under the influence of the pressure source acting on the barrier; a first pressure transducer to detect the pressure associated with the first pump chamber and a second pressure transducer to detect the pressure associated with the second pump chamber, and a controller configured to receive pressure information from the pressure transducers, and to use the pressure information to determine the liquid volumes being pumped through the first and second pump chambers before mixing, allowing the concentration of the second liquid in first liquid to be determined during mixing. - View Dependent Claims (10, 11, 12, 13, 14, 15, 16, 17)
